So since I sold my V6 Focus, I was search all over the PNW for a nice 95-97 Lexus LS400. manage to find this one last week, hopped the ferry over to the mainland and snapped it up.

1996 LS400, Metalic Silver on Grey leather interior, full load with the Nakamichi sound system (still an amazing system considering it's age!) 181,469km when I bought it, was a fresh rebuild but only got lightly tagged in the rear and the insurance company didn't even bother to properly assess the damages. I had it on the hoist and went over it with a fine tooth comb and was in amazing shape. No way it was worse than a $1500 hit. So I got this thing for a steal of a deal. Needs a little maintenance work but I expected that with any used car. Paid $3500 for the car and have already ordered $2900 in parts including some new BC BR coils, new crystal clear headlights and red/clear/red LED tails, lots of maintenance stuff, hiJacked a set of 06 GS430 wheels for the interim.

I am planning to upgrade the BC's with a UAS kit in the summer. I only plan to keep the car a few years as my goal is to find a nice 2000/2001 LS. One that I can swap all my suspension parts over too, build myself a proper set of wheels and keep that car for a decade. For now, i'm just going to make do with a nice set of 20x9.5s all around, slam it and use it as a DD.

If we both find some time, my buddy Greg and I (since I left my welder and all my fabricating tools back in vancouver with my dad) will be building an exhaust for the car this winter.

Being back in school, I'm on a tight budget... Ballin' on a budget so to speak!
Come summer time when I'm working full time again, I hope to be able to finish out the suspension and redo the stereo to get them where I want them.
